Half-remembered Throwback Thursday Encounter

I was reading an article about African-American abstractionists that mentioned the work of Howardena Pindell.  I thought about a time, around 1992, that I gave her a ride in my 1982 Chevette.  she gave a lecture at Old Dominion University As part of a show at the Chrysler Museum in Norfolk, VA. I can’t remember if she did any studio visits. Since I vividly remember Robert Colescott’s visit around the same time, I do not think she came by our studios. I do remember she and the Chrysler’s curator of contemporary art, Trinket Clark, were late getting back to the museum. Perhaps that is why they didn’t flinch at the state of my “art ride.” I don’t even remember if someone suggested I drive them or if I volunteered. Unfortunately, I can’t find any mention of the show online but if I remember correctly, Faith Ringgold was also included. Perhaps my memory is a little fuzzy and it was another artist in the car but I believe it was her and I would have remembered if it was Ringgold since she had rejected my work from a juried show a year or two before and that still stung a bit.

I’ve been fortunate enough to meet a number of great artists and musicians. I should write about hanging out with The Minutemen in a house with no running water or not going up speak with Roy Lichtenstein at a party on a house boat in New York. There are more Thursdays coming.
